Oh and if you're making this poster from scratch, you'll want to do it in vectors so it doesn't like look a pixelated mess when you blow it up to poster size.
Inkscape is a freeware vector program that can save to standard SVG files.
It does have an option to trace bitmaps and create vectors, but it's not very good. Vector Magic, by Stanford, is much better at tracing bitmaps to vector images, but they want about $3 per image.
